Earthworm Jim is a run and gun platform game developed by Shiny Entertainment, first released for the Sega Mega Drive in 1994. The premise is delightfully absurd: you play as Jim, an ordinary earthworm who discovers a robotic suit that grants him incredible powers, and he sets off to rescue Princess What's-Her-Name from the villainous Psy-Crow. Notably, the Mega Drive version includes an extra level not found on the Super Nintendo release, as the cartridge format allowed for additional content. The game is celebrated for its cartoon-style graphics, which were groundbreaking for the Mega Drive, with fluid animations and Jim's expressive movements bringing the character to life in ways few games of the era could match. Upon its original release it was praised for its detailed animation, polished gameplay and surreal humour, and it became the first game ever to receive a 100% review in GamesMaster magazine.
